Elements of Fiction
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Author's viewpoint | How he or she feels about the subject. |
| Foreshadowing | To provide a int of what may occur later on in the plot. |
| Symbolism | The author creates symbols from ordinary parts of the plot. |
| Imagery | Presents pictures painted with words to help the reader feel and experience what the author is describing. |
| Irony | When something happens that is the opposite of what is expected. |
